Transaction 770945742536a99988cec6085bb9933107fb5c1c8dded8caa1f5bf855d897296
1 Input
1 Output
-
770945742536a99988cec6085bb9933107fb5c1c8dded8caa1f5bf855d897296:0
- value
- 964483
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 fc2f8a47e510ba2c911128e649cd5008a7c7d049 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1PzSEVPY674kwBe1dd5PwtPzvx9r23w7wG